git: openjdk/loom: jom-master: Removed all the code related to caller frameId.
duke
duke at openjdk.org
Thu Aug 3 08:01:55 UTC 2023
Changeset: 2d69f29c
Author: David Holmes <david.holmes at oracle.com>
Date: 2023-08-03 03:57:12 +0000
URL: https://git.openjdk.org/loom/commit/2d69f29cc978e040343bdb473c827cf64320c013
Removed all the code related to caller frameId.
Fixed a bug in the virtual thread support where we didn't account for BoundVirtualThreads.
Added new abortException method
Abort if any of the Object monitor enter/exit methods throw excexptions (debugging/testing aid)
! src/hotspot/cpu/x86/interp_masm_x86.cpp
! src/hotspot/cpu/x86/interp_masm_x86.hpp
! src/hotspot/cpu/x86/templateInterpreterGenerator_x86.cpp
! src/hotspot/cpu/x86/templateTable_x86.cpp
! src/hotspot/share/classfile/javaClasses.cpp
! src/hotspot/share/classfile/vmIntrinsics.hpp
! src/hotspot/share/classfile/vmSymbols.hpp
! src/hotspot/share/include/jvm.h
! src/hotspot/share/interpreter/abstractInterpreter.cpp
! src/hotspot/share/interpreter/abstractInterpreter.hpp
! src/hotspot/share/interpreter/templateInterpreterGenerator.cpp
! src/hotspot/share/interpreter/templateInterpreterGenerator.hpp
! src/hotspot/share/memory/universe.cpp
! src/hotspot/share/memory/universe.hpp
! src/hotspot/share/prims/jvm.cpp
! src/hotspot/share/runtime/arguments.cpp
! src/hotspot/share/runtime/globals.hpp
! src/hotspot/share/runtime/javaThread.hpp
! src/hotspot/share/runtime/synchronizer.cpp
! src/hotspot/share/runtime/synchronizer.hpp
! src/java.base/share/classes/java/lang/Monitor.java
! src/java.base/share/classes/java/lang/MonitorSupport.java
! src/java.base/share/classes/java/lang/Object.java
! src/java.base/share/classes/java/lang/Thread.java
! src/java.base/share/native/libjava/Monitor.c
More information about the loom-dev
mailing list